Output 6d51d0e5c3ce1a28b975228af5bc95e300dd4b3c40e26fb1826652a9e5bd1da3:1

value
6667263
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 efc14f6e8bc252ae1d723ee314ef999c36c1cea6 OP_EQUALVERIFY OP_CHECKSIG
address
1Nri5HK4emy9bn15QyErRdAZTFGZWRz6Hj
transaction
6d51d0e5c3ce1a28b975228af5bc95e300dd4b3c40e26fb1826652a9e5bd1da3
confirmations
406861
spent
true